Tuya ZG-204ZL Bewegungsmelder in Lichtsteuerungsautomation

Hallo,

ich habe für Räume ohne Präsenzsensor (z. B. Bad, Flur) den Tuya Mini Bewegungsmelder mit Lichtsensor (ZG-204ZL) im Einsatz:
https://www.zigbee2mqtt.io/devices/ZG-204ZL.html

Problem ist der Lichtsensor in Kombination mit der Lichtautomation.
Beim ersten Mal funktioniert alles korrekt: Bewegung → Lux unter Schwellwert → Licht an.
Nach Ablauf der Zeit geht das Licht aus, aber bei erneuter Bewegung bleibt es aus.

Grund: Der Lichtsensor aktualisiert sich zu selten.
Während das Licht an war, meldet der Sensor „hell“. Nach dem Ausschalten dauert es zu lange, bis ein neuer niedriger Lux-Wert kommt. In der Zeit verhindert die Automation das Einschalten.

Das Illuminance-Intervall habe ich bereits auf 1 Minute gesetzt, bringt aber keine Lösung.

Im Wohnzimmer nutze ich einen Aqara FP2, dort tritt das Problem nicht auf (dauerhafte Stromversorgung, häufige Lux-Updates). Mir ist klar, dass der Tuya batteriebetrieben ist.

Meine Frage:
Gibt es eine sinnvolle Lösung, um den ZG-204ZL trotzdem zuverlässig für Lux-basierte Lichtautomationen zu nutzen, oder ist der Sensor dafür schlicht ungeeignet und ein separater Lichtsensor die bessere Lösung?

Leider kann ich aktuell meinen YAML-Code nicht einfügen, da dann der Browser-Tab abstürzt.

Hier mein YAML-Code hier kann ich ihn einfügen.

alias: "Flur Lichtsteuerung"
description: ""
triggers:
  - type: occupied
    device_id: 5f1c932cd08dd9f69088f18045bdeb53
    entity_id: 983a3623bbe22946c2937e329eeaa194
    domain: binary_sensor
    trigger: device
    id: belegt
  - type: not_occupied
    device_id: 5f1c932cd08dd9f69088f18045bdeb53
    entity_id: 983a3623bbe22946c2937e329eeaa194
    domain: binary_sensor
    trigger: device
    id: frei
    for:
      hours: 0
      minutes: 0
      seconds: 30
  - entity_id:
      - sensor.tuya_mini_lux_bewegungsmelder_flur_illuminance
    below: 600
    for:
      hours: 0
      minutes: 1
      seconds: 0
      milliseconds: 0
    id: dunkel
    trigger: numeric_state
  - entity_id:
      - sensor.tuya_mini_lux_bewegungsmelder_flur_illuminance
    above: 2700
    for:
      hours: 0
      minutes: 2
      seconds: 0
      milliseconds: 0
    id: hell
    trigger: numeric_state
conditions: []
actions:
  - choose:
      - conditions:
          - condition: trigger
            id: frei
        sequence:
          - action: switch.turn_off
            data: {}
            target:
              entity_id: switch.sonoff_zbminir2_flur_eingang
      - conditions:
          - condition: or
            conditions:
              - condition: trigger
                id: belegt
              - condition: trigger
                id: dunkel
          - condition: state
            state:
              - "on"
            entity_id: binary_sensor.tuya_mini_lux_bewegungsmelder_flur_occupancy
          - condition: numeric_state
            entity_id: sensor.tuya_mini_lux_bewegungsmelder_flur_illuminance
            below: 600
        sequence:
          - action: switch.turn_on
            data: {}
            target:
              entity_id: switch.sonoff_zbminir2_flur_eingang
      - conditions:
          - condition: trigger
            id: hell
        sequence:
          - action: switch.turn_off
            data: {}
            target:
              entity_id: switch.sonoff_zbminir2_flur_eingang
mode: restart

Danke.

:crayon:by HarryP: Zusammenführung Doppelpost (bei Änderungen oder hinzufügen von Inhalten bitte die „Bearbeitungsfunktion“ anstatt „Antworten“ zu nutzen)